Legal basis for processing personal data

The legal basis for obtaining consent is Article 6(1)(a) and Article 7 GDPR, the legal basis for processing to fulfill our services and carry out contractual measures as well as answering inquiries is Article 6(1)(b). GDPR, the legal basis for processing to fulfill our legal obligations is Article 6(1)(c) GDPR, and the legal basis for processing to safeguard our legitimate interests is Article 6(1)(f) GDPR. In the event that vital interests of the data subject or another natural person require the processing of personal data, Article 6 Paragraph 1 lit. d GDPR serves as the legal basis.

Data collection and processing when accessed from the Internet

In order to use our website for informational purposes only, it is generally not necessary for you to provide personal data. When you visit our websites, our web server saves each access in a log file (so-called server log files). The following data is recorded and stored: IP address of the requesting computer, date and time of access, URL of the retrieved file, message as to whether the retrieval was successful and the access status (file transferred, file not found, etc.), amount of data transferred, identification data of the browser used, website from which access is made.
This data is processed for the purpose of enabling use of the website (establishing a connection), system security, technical administration of the network infrastructure and optimization of the internet offer. The IP address is only evaluated by us in the event of attacks on the network infrastructure (Art. 6 Para. 1 lit. f GDPR).

cookies

The website partially uses so-called cookies. Cookies do not damage your computer and do not contain viruses. Cookies serve to make our offer more user-friendly, effective and secure. Cookies are small text files that are stored on your computer and saved by your browser. The cookies cannot be assigned to specific persons and do not contain any personal data. Most of the cookies we use are so-called “session cookies”. They are automatically deleted after your visit. Other cookies remain stored on your end device until you delete them. These cookies enable us to recognize your browser on your next visit.

If users do not want cookies to be stored on their computer, they are asked to deactivate the corresponding option in their browser's system settings. Saved cookies can be deleted in the system settings of the browser. The exclusion of cookies can lead to functional restrictions of this online offer.

data subject rights

You have the right:

  • pursuant to Art. 7 Para. 3 GDPR, to revoke the consent you have given to us at any time. As a result, we are no longer allowed to continue the data processing based on this consent for the future;

  • to request information about your personal data processed by us in accordance with Art. 15 GDPR. In particular, you can obtain information about the processing purposes, the category of personal data, the categories of recipients to whom your data was or will be disclosed, the planned storage period, the existence of a right to correction, deletion, restriction of processing or objection, the existence of a Right to complain, the origin of your data, if not collected from us, and the existence of automated decision-making including profiling and, if necessary, meaningful information about their details;

  • in accordance with Art. 16 GDPR, to immediately request the correction of incorrect or incomplete personal data stored by us;

  • According to Art. 17 GDPR, to request the deletion of your personal data stored by us, unless the processing is necessary to exercise the right to freedom of expression and information, to fulfill a legal obligation, for reasons of public interest or to assert, exercise or defend legal claims is required;

  • pursuant to Art. 18 GDPR, to request the restriction of the processing of your personal data if you dispute the accuracy of the data, the processing is unlawful, but you refuse to delete it and we no longer need the data, but you use them to assert, exercise or defense of legal claims or you have objected to the processing pursuant to Art. 21 GDPR;

  • in accordance with Art. 20 GDPR, to receive your personal data that you have provided to us in a structured, common and machine-readable format or to request transmission to another person responsible and

  • to complain to a supervisory authority in accordance with Art. 77 GDPR. As a rule, you can contact the supervisory authority of your usual place of residence or work or our company.
